Game Summary
The Milwaukee Brewers will host the Philadelphia Phillies at the American Family Field in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, on September 18. Both teams are looking to solidify their playoff spots as the regular season winds down. The Brewers come into this game with a record of 87-64, showcasing a strong performance this season, particularly at home, where they are 43-30. On the other hand, the Phillies hold a record of 91-60 and have been dominant, especially on the road, with a 39-34 record.
Milwaukee's offense has been productive, ranking 4th in the league with 732 runs scored and 9th in hits with 1272. Their batting average of .250 places them 8th in the league. The Brewers have also shown power with 50 saves, tied for 2nd in the league. However, their pitching staff has been solid, ranking 4th in ERA at 3.65.
The Phillies boast an equally impressive offense, ranking 4th in hits with 1326 and tied for 5th in runs with 727. Their batting average of .258 also ranks 4th, showcasing their capacity to score. Philadelphia's pitching is slightly behind Milwaukee, with a 7th ranking in ERA at 3.76. Their bullpen has been effective but has had its ups and downs, as evidenced by their 36 saves.
Both teams have faced each other multiple times this season, and historical matchups indicate a tight contest. With both teams fighting for postseason positioning, expect a fiercely competitive game with plenty of action. Freddy Peralta is slated to start for the Brewers, bringing an 11-8 record with a 3.75 ERA. He'll face off against Aaron Nola, who has a 12-8 record and a slightly lower ERA of 3.62. This pitching duel could be the key to determining the outcome of the game.

Team Previews
Milwaukee Brewers
The Brewers have established themselves as a formidable team in the league, especially with their powerful batting lineup led by Willy Adames, who has hit 32 home runs and driven in 109 RBIs this season. William Contreras has also contributed significantly with a batting average of .281. The pitching staff, led by Freddy Peralta, has been reliable, and the team has depth in the bullpen with 50 saves this season. Their fielding has been solid, but they must avoid errors, which have been an issue at times this season.
Philadelphia Phillies
The Phillies have a dynamic offense featuring Trea Turner, who leads the team with a .299 batting average, and Kyle Schwarber, who has 35 home runs and 97 RBIs. Their pitching rotation, headed by Aaron Nola, has been strong but has faced challenges against high-scoring teams. The Phillies' bullpen has been effective with 36 saves but will need to maintain consistency. Their fielding has been a bit shaky, and addressing this could be crucial for their success in this matchup.
